Join a Park Ranger at Rocky Mountain National Park for a kid-friendly snowshoe adventure on the west side of the park. Snowshoeing is a fun way to experience the backcountry of Rocky Mountain National Park and is a great family activity! The programs will be held on Saturdays; January 9, February 6 and March 6 at 10:30 a.m. Ages 6-12 are welcome with an adult. Participants should dress warmly, in layers and furnish their own equipment. All snowshoe walks require reservations. Reservations can be made in advance, seven days or less prior to the desired walk. To make reservations for west side snowshoe walks, call the Kawuneeche Visitor Center at (970) 627-3471 between 8:00 a.m. and 4:30 p.m. daily.
